Skip to content

media_player: add an API entry to enable/display the OSD rendering

By default the VLC OSD (play/pause/mute logos, volume slider, seek slider) is enabled. This may not be welcome in libvlc apps that just want the video to be rendered and/or show these things their own way.

We need a way to enable/disable these OSD features, either individually or as a whole.

We may also change the default value as most of the time host apps don't want this. This is mostly useful in the context of the VideoLAN player(s).

To upload designs, you'll need to enable LFS and have an admin enable hashed storage. More information